Glitz, glam, sun and sand

This 60 mile stretch of beautiful Atlantic shoreline between Miami and West Palm Beach is the place to see and be seen. Relax and shop by day...party by night

There are a myriad of ways to enjoy your Gold Coast Florida holiday. Relax on one of the Gold Coast’s famous beaches while the private yachts go by. Shop, dine and indulge in everything exclusive Boca Raton has to offer or take a drive up to Cocoa Beach and experience the Gold Coast’s legendary surf.

Where to stay

If you’ll be spending your days on the beach and nights on the town, you can’t go wrong staying in West Palm Beach or Boca Raton. And if you’re after the Coast’s championship golf courses, you’ll find them in Boca Raton and Fort Lauderdale. For a lazy, relaxing holiday, head up north to the small seaside towns.

Weather in the Gold Coast

As it's in the southern part of the state, the Gold Coast benefits from warm, tropical weather all year long. It rarely rains, and you can expect sun almost every day.
